Essay from the year 2008 in the subject Politics - International Politics - Region: Near East, Near Orient, grade: 1,0, Muhlenberg College, course: The Modern Middle East, language: English, abstract: In the modern Middle East, political questions often seem to be tied closely to religious concerns. This occurs especially in the development of independent states in the 20th century, when capable and strong governments had to be formed. The question how to in- or exclude religions from the government and political affairs is a hot topic, and displays a huge influence of religion even on the state structures. The essay does discuss what impact the question on religion has on certain modern Middle Eastern states. Therefore, a comparison between Iran, Israel, and Lebanon is made.
